select * will just hdfs cat your file when you are using serde, do you have column separator in place? if not can you do select * from table limit 1
to get normally a single coulmn you should do select column from table where column=value On Mon, Dec 17, 2012 at 1:51 PM, Mohit Chaudhary01 < mohit_chaudhar...@infosys.com> wrote: > Hi**** > > I am using serde in hive to store data into hive table from xml file. **** > > Whenever I retrieve data using command select * from table it give all > records from table.**** > > ** ** > > But when I want to extract an individual column it gives error .**** > > *Please Tell me how can I retrieve a single column from this table.* > > * * > > *Thanks * > > *Mohit chaudhary* > > **************** CAUTION - Disclaimer ***************** > This e-mail contains PRIVILEGED AND CONFIDENTIAL INFORMATION intended solely > for the use of the addressee(s). If you are not the intended recipient, please > notify the sender by e-mail and delete the original message. Further, you are > not > to copy, disclose, or distribute this e-mail or its contents to any other > person and > any such actions are unlawful. This e-mail may contain viruses. Infosys has > taken > every reasonable precaution to minimize this risk, but is not liable for any > damage > you may sustain as a result of any virus in this e-mail. You should carry out > your > own virus checks before opening the e-mail or attachment. Infosys reserves the > right to monitor and review the content of all messages sent to or from this > e-mail > address. Messages sent to or from this e-mail address may be stored on the > Infosys e-mail system. > ***INFOSYS******** End of Disclaimer ********INFOSYS*** > > -- Nitin Pawar